Bottle 750ml.Clear medium orange yellow colour with a small to average, fizzy, fair lacing, mostly diminishing, white head. Aroma is moderate malty, pale malt, light caramel, moderate yeasty, earthy, vomit, moldy - fusty. Flavour is moderate sweet with a average duration, moldy - fusty, malty. Body is medium, texture is oily, carbonation is soft. [20130104]

Bottle 75 cl. Courtesy of fonefan. Pours a hazy golden with some floating impurities. Sweet caramellish and fruity nose with some Belgian esters. Fairly rich body, low in carbonation, sweet and fruity with a little yeast. 050113

Bottle, unfiltered
It has a light amber (or deep golden) color, with a nice creamy head. The aroma is malty, with very light yeast and hops; the flavor is quite malty too, with some caramel, round, very smooth, with low bitterness; both aroma and flavor have a very light touch of vegetables (which is a flaw). Overall simple, but a positive beer.
